Instructions

Mix together all spices and make two portions.

Fry onion in oil till golden brown.

Separate fried onion from oil , cool and grind.

Now add 1/2 quantity of ground onion, 1/2 quantity of spices, 1/2 quantity of yoghurt to the minced meat and knead well.

Make small balls like kofta from this kneaded minced meat and keep aside.

Now add remaining grinded onion, yoghurt, spices , garlic, ginger to the oil and fry for 2-3 minutes.

Add 2 glass of water and cook on medium flame for 10 minutes, then introduce meat balls (kofta) slowly, and continue cooking on low flame till meat is tender ( 45-60 minutes) and gravy become thick.

Garnish with fresh coriander leaves.

Serve with Naan/Roti and salad.
